What is a drop-leaf table used for?

A drop-leaf table is a type of furniture that is designed to provide an efficient solution to space limitations. It typically features a table-top with two hinged sides that can be raised or lowered when needed, allowing you to expand or reduce the size of the table.

Due to its adjustable nature, it can easily be used in various locations. For example, in the corner of a room, it can provide a useful work-surface for writing or for preparing meals, freeing up other spaces for other uses when not needed.

Alternatively, it can be used as a dining table, as it can be easily adapted to fit the size of the group, or even to just provide an occasional table for snacks or beverages. The versatility of the drop-leaf table is what makes it such a useful piece of furniture for anyone who might find their room size is too limiting.

How do I identify an antique table?

When considering whether a table is an antique, the first step is to consider the age of the item. Most antique tables will be at least 100 years old. It’s important to remember that if a piece of furniture looks old, it doesn’t necessarily mean it is an antique.

To get a better sense of the age, look for clues such as the type of wood used (antique tables are more likely to have been made with solid woods such as oak, mahogany, and walnut) or the type of joinery used (dovetail joints may indicate an older piece).

Additionally, inspect the finish of the table. Measure the depth of color on the surface of the table; older tables will have a deeper patina on their surfaces. Check to see if any renovation has been done to the table; this could indicate a newer furniture item.

Lastly, look for a marking or signature on the table; some antique furniture pieces may have a label or maker’s mark that can also help to date the table.

How can you tell how old a table is?

There are various ways to tell how old a table is, such as examining the craftsmanship, looking for identifying marks, assessing the materials used, and determining the style.

Examining the craftsmanship is a good way to tell the age of a table. Antique and vintage furniture often have superior craftsmanship with dovetail joints and thicker, solid wood pieces. Often antique tables will have sections with hand-stitched or plain seams, that are not very uniform like they would be today.

Looking at the details and craftsmanship is a surefire way to help you judge the age of a table.

Look for identifying marks that indicate the manufacturer or maker of the table. If a table has a mark or other identifying characteristics (usually found on the bottom or bottom edge of the table) such as a manufacturer’s name, trademark, or label, this can indicate the age of the table, since the mark would have been made when it was constructed.

Assessing the materials used to construct the table can also help in telling the age. Newer tables usually use contemporary, high-quality materials and finishes, whereas antique tables may use more intricate veneers, detailed carvings, and different stains and colors.

Furthermore, the type of material used will also help in determining the age of a table, so be sure to examine the different components of the table, such as the type of wood, the finishes, and the edges or peaks of the table.

Finally, determining the style is an effective way to tell how old a table is. Different styles indicate certain periods of furniture design and creation, such as French antique or Mid-Century Modern, allowing you to pinpoint the age of the table.

Knowing the style of a table can also be helpful in identifying makers and manufacturers, which can provide an even more precise age of the item.
